About

Toshio Seki is a scholar working on Computational Mechanics,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Toshio Seki has authored 239 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 153 papers in Computational Mechanics, 151 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 87 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Toshio Seki’s work include Ion-surface interactions and analysis (152 papers),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(107 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(75 papers). Toshio Seki is often cited by papers focused on Ion-surface interactions and analysis (152 papers),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(107 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(75 papers). Toshio Seki coll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Germany. Toshio Seki's co-authors include Jiro Matsuo, Takaaki Aoki, Satoshi Ninomiya, Kazuya Ichiki, Yoshihiko Nakata, Isao Yamada, Hideaki Yamada, Kanji Kawachi, Noriaki Toyoda and Tetsuji Kawata and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Applied Physics Letters and Journal of the American College of Cardiology.
